Frontend-Einsteigerkurs: HTML5-Strukturen, CSS3-Styling, JavaScript-Programmierung — die Web-Frontend-Basis für Entwickler.
Geprüft von Admin Kursweg · Stand 25. Mai 2026
Was wird in diesem Kurs vermittelt
Wer im Web entwickelt, braucht alle drei Basis-Technologien: HTML für Struktur, CSS für Styling, JavaScript für Verhalten. Dieser Kurs vermittelt die Grundlagen und ist Einstiegspunkt für moderne Web-Entwicklung (React, Angular, Vue) oder klassische Backend-Entwicklung mit HTML/CSS/JS-Frontend. Block HTML5-Grundlagen: Dokument-Struktur (DOCTYPE, html, head, body), Meta-Tags (charset, viewport, description, robots), semantische Tags (header, nav, main, article, section, aside, footer), Inhaltselemente (p, h1-h6, ul/ol/li, blockquote, code, pre), Inline-Formatierung (strong, em, span, a, img), Form-Elemente (input mit allen Types, textarea, select, button, fieldset, legend), Form-Validation mit HTML5 (required, pattern, min/max), Tabellen (table, thead, tbody, tr, td, th, mit colspan/rowspan), Media-Tags (audio, video, picture mit source-Tags für Responsive Images), Semantic Search Optimization. Block CSS3-Styling: Selektoren (Element, Class, ID, Attribut, Pseudo-Class wie :hover/:focus/:nth-child, Pseudo-Element wie ::before/::after, Kombinatoren), Box Model (margin, border, padding, content — box-sizing: border-box als Standard), Display (block, inline, inline-block, none, flex, grid), Position (static, relative, absolute, fixed, sticky), Typography (font-family, font-size, font-weight, line-height, letter-spacing, text-transform), Colors (Hex, RGB, RGBA, HSL, HSLA, named Colors), Background (color, image, gradient, position, repeat, size, attachment), Flexbox-Grundlagen (flex-direction, justify-content, align-items, gap), Grid-Grundlagen (grid-template-columns/rows, grid-area), Transitions (transition-property/duration/timing-function), einfache Animationen (@keyframes, animation), Responsive Design mit Media Queries. Block JavaScript-Grundlagen: Variablen (let, const, var und ihre Unterschiede), Datentypen (Number, String, Boolean, Object, Array, null, undefined, Symbol), Operatoren (arithmetisch, vergleichend, logisch, ternär), Kontrollstrukturen (if/else, switch, while, for, for...of, for...in), Funktionen (Function Declaration, Function Expression, Arrow Functions), Scope (Global, Function, Block), Closures, Higher-Order Functions (map, filter, reduce, forEach). Block DOM-Manipulation: document.getElementById/querySelector/querySelectorAll, Element-Eigenschaften (textContent, innerHTML, classList, style, dataset), DOM-Manipulation (createElement, appendChild, removeChild, insertBefore), Event-Handling (addEventListener, Event-Objekt, preventDefault, stopPropagation, Delegation). Block Asynchrone Programmierung: Callbacks (mit Problem: Callback Hell), Promises (then/catch/finally, Promise.all, Promise.race), async/await als moderne Syntax, Fetch API für HTTP-Requests. Block Module: ES Modules (import/export), CommonJS (für Node.js). Block Visual Studio (oder VS Code) für Web-Entwicklung: Setup, Debugging (Chrome DevTools, VS Code Debugger), Browser DevTools (Elements, Console, Network, Sources, Performance, Application).
Marktdaten zu Verdienst, offenen Stellen und Zukunftsaussicht im Bereich IT & Informatik
Einstieg
38.000–48.000 €
0–2 Jahre Erfahrung
Mittel
52.000–68.000 €
3–7 Jahre Erfahrung
Senior
70.000–95.000 €
8+ Jahre / Lead-Rolle
124.000+
IT-Berufe sind seit fünf Jahren der größte Fachkräfteengpass am deutschen Arbeitsmarkt. Der Bestand offener IT-Stellen ist 2024 auf einen Rekordstand gestiegen; AI- und Cloud-Skills werden in den nächsten Jahren weiter überdurchschnittlich nachgefragt.
Bei AZAV-zertifizierten Trägern ist die Kursgebühr regelmäßig zu 100 % förderbar.
VS Code (Microsoft, kostenfrei, Cross-Platform) ist heute Standard. Der Kurs-Titel erwähnt Visual Studio 2017 (Legacy) — moderner Anbieter sollten VS Code nutzen.
Frontend-Frameworks: React (am häufigsten), Angular (enterprise-orientiert), Vue (einsteigerfreundlich). Build-Tools (Webpack, Vite). TypeScript als JS-Erweiterung mit Typen.
Für Junior-Stellen mit Framework-Add-on ja. Senior braucht Framework-Expertise + State Management (Redux, Pinia) + Testing + Performance.
Ja, AZAV-Anbieter akzeptieren Bildungsgutschein, QCG, bAvH.
Einstieg in Python: Syntax, Datentypen, Kontrollstrukturen, Funktionen und Fehlerbehandlung. Grundlage für Datenanalyse, Web-Entwicklung, Scripting und Automation. Keine Programmier-Vorkenntnisse nötig.
Sprachenübergreifender Einstiegskurs für Software-Entwicklung: Grundlagen-Konzepte, Programmiersprachen-Vergleich (Python, Java, C#, JavaScript), UML-Modellierung und SQL. Brücke aus dem Quereinstieg in einen spezialisierten Entwickler-Kurs.
Vertiefung nach dem Python-Grundkurs: objektorientierte Programmierung, Vererbung, GUI-Entwicklung, Datei- und Datenbank-Zugriff. Voraussetzung für Junior-Python-Entwickler-Positionen.
Von gestaltendem Webdesign zur echten Web-Entwicklung: JavaScript, jQuery, PHP und Ajax. Eigene Plugins anpassen, Slideshows steuern, dynamische Inhalte einbinden. Brücke für Designer mit Code-Ambition.
Sag uns einmal Region, Format (online/präsenz), Zeit-Modell und Förderstatus — wir vergleichen für dich und melden uns mit 1–3 passenden Trägern. Kostenlos, unverbindlich.
Typischer Verlauf nach dem Kurs
Quellen: Bundesagentur für Arbeit · Engpassanalyse 2024/25 · StepStone Gehaltsreport 2025 · Bitkom Studie Fachkräftemangel 2024. Brutto-Jahresgehälter aus Erhebungen 2024/25, abweichend nach Region und Tarifgebundenheit.